ha yes! i have the Dolemite box set and have to say that while Dolemite is his most famous movie, the best work of Rudy Ray Moore can be found in "Petey Wheatstraw: The Devil's Son-In-Law".

 

Also, if you like Dolemite, you MUST SEE Black Dynamite. It's a great spoof of the 70s Blacksploitation genre. Lots of Dolemite references.

Disco Godfather is in the boxset too, along with The Human Tornado rounding out the pack. Theyre all basically the same movie with different jokes. All stupendous. The opening scene of Petey Wheatstraw is legendary.

 

The DVDs of RRM's stand up included in the boxset however, are too painful to get through.
